Description

APPLE INC has the following available in Cupertino, California and various unanticipated locations throughout the USA. Responsible for all aspects of physical design verifications including: physical verification methodology for SOC, full chip integration flows, physical verification convergence, and closure, and final signoff. Apply knowledge of detailed block level analysis, work on chip floor planning and block interface issues, and understand deep submicron process technology. Work with process variation, various timing margins and derates, and detailed tool /runset settings. Work with both Physical Design Engineers and foundry for new PDK evaluation and qualification, block level physical verification debugging, full chip level debug and rule settings, and work on detailed specifications for block, block assemble level, and full chip level validation specs. Execute physical verification runs, maintain and innovate scripts and infrastructure, and provide documentation for guidelines and specs. Apply strong signoff ownership to ensure first silicon success. 40 hours/week. At Apple, base pay is one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ree or foreign equivalent in Electrical Engineering or related field, and 5 years of progressive, post baccalaureate experience in the job offered or related occupation.
  • 5 years of experience with each of the following skills is required:
  • Utilizing very-large-scale integration (VLSI) design and experience understanding logic design, data path analysis and digital design flow.
  • Experience in floor planning, placement and optimization, physical design routing and physical verification, using PnR and PDV (Calibre) CAD tools.
  • Experience performing automation, writing scripts and implementing design, using tool command language (TCL) and shell scripting.
  • Experience in Power, Performance and Area analysis
  • Analyzing Static timing and Static & Dynamic voltage
  • Experience in Physical verification, and experience in layout versus schematic checks.
  • Understanding of device physics, semiconductor process and interconnect electrical behaviors, including experience identifying solutions with signoff check violations.
